Wimbledon: Novak Djokovic beats Cam Norie to book final spot against Nick Kyrgios

Novak Djokovic defeated Cam Norie 2-6, 6-3, 6-2, 6-4 on center court to reach his eighth Wimbledon final.

Djokovic sets up a final against Nick Kyrgios on Sunday when the top-ranked Serb will be aiming for his fourth straight Wimbledon title – and seventh overall.

Kyrgios entered his first Grand Slam final when Rafael Nadal withdrew from the tournament on Thursday with an abdominal injury.

Nori was playing his first Grand Slam semi-final and surprisingly broke Djokovic three times in the first set, but did not manage a single break point after that. 3–3 in the second set, Djokovic won 11 of the next 13 games to take a 2–0 lead in the fourth.
